Role Summary:
Heven AeroTech is seeking a Senior Director of Pricing to own pricing strategy and execution across our hardware, software, and services lines. This individual will start as a hands-on, working pricing leader - building models, developing cost volumes, and supporting live pursuits - while simultaneously standing up the processes, tools, and governance that will let the function scale into a full pricing team as the company grows. The role requires significant experience pricing in the federal government market, with commercial pricing experience a strong plus, and demands comfort moving fluidly between BOM-based hardware cost modeling, software/IP pricing, and services labor-based pricing.

Essential Responsibilities:
  • Serve as the hands-on, working pricing lead across active pursuits, developing pricing strategies, cost volumes, and Basis of Estimates (BOEs) for hardware, software, and services offerings
  • Build out the pricing function from the ground up, including pricing models, templates, review gates, and governance designed to scale as the company and pipeline grow
  • Recruit, build, and ultimately lead a pricing team, providing mentorship and training as the function expands beyond a single working leader
  • Develop BOM-based hardware and component cost models reflecting manufacturing costs, supply chain sourcing (including NATO-allied and domestic content considerations), and volume/scale assumptions relevant to Heven's platforms
  • Develop services pricing models across labor categories and contract types (FFP, T&M, cost-reimbursable), and software/IP pricing approaches appropriate to federal and commercial customers
  • Partner with Capture Managers, BD Directors, Program Management, Contracts, and Solutions Architecture to develop compliant, competitive pricing aligned to technical solutions and win strategy
  • Ensure pricing compliance with FAR/DFARS cost and pricing regulations, TINA and Certified Cost or Pricing Data requirements, and Cost Accounting Standards (CAS), maintaining audit readiness for DCAA/DCMA reviews
  • Support indirect rate structure development, forward pricing rate proposals, and wrap rate maintenance in coordination with Finance and Contracts
  • Provide pricing trade-off analysis and executive-level recommendations at Gate reviews and bid/no-bid decisions, balancing competitiveness with margin and cost realism
  • Track competitive pricing intelligence and market benchmarks across federal and adjacent commercial hardware, software, and services markets
  • Bring commercial pricing disciplines (e.g., value-based or market-based pricing) into federal pursuits where appropriate, particularly for software and recurring services offerings
  • Provide accurate, timely pricing status and risk reporting consistent with company-wide BD and Finance operating rhythm

Qualifications & Experience:

Required:
  • 12+ years of pricing, cost estimating, or related financial leadership experience within the federal government contracting market (DoW and/or Federal Civilian), with a track record of pricing competitive, awarded pursuits
  • Deep working knowledge of FAR/DFARS cost and pricing regulations, TINA/Certified Cost or Pricing Data requirements, and CAS, with demonstrated DCAA/DCMA audit experience
  • Demonstrated experience pricing across hardware, software, and services simultaneously, including BOM-based hardware/component cost modeling alongside labor-based services pricing
  • Proven ability to build and scale a pricing function, including the processes, tools, and governance that make pricing repeatable and compliant as an organization grows
  • Strong financial modeling skills (advanced Excel required) and experience with cost estimating tools, ERP systems, or pricing software
  • Demonstrated ability to work as an individual, hands-on contributor while building toward a team leadership role
  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Business, Economics, Engineering, or a related field
  • Ability to obtain and maintain a DoD Secret clearance

Preferred:
  • MBA or equivalent advanced degree
  • Commercial pricing experience (e.g., SaaS, hardware, or manufactured products), bringing market- and value-based pricing techniques to complement federal cost-based pricing
  • Experience pricing hardware or manufactured components in an aerospace, defense, or advanced manufacturing environment
  • Experience pricing under Other Transaction Agreements (OTAs), Commercial Solutions Openings (CSOs), or Commercial Item determinations, in addition to traditional FAR-based cost/price approaches
  • Certified Professional Pricing (CPP) or similar pricing/cost estimating certification
  • Familiarity with Blue UAS/NDAA compliance considerations and how they affect component sourcing and cost structure
